Power disruption

May 20, 2024

Following maintenance works taken up by CESC at Chamalapura Power Distribution Centre, there will be no power supply tomorrow between 10 am and 5 pm in Koodagalli, B. Seehalli, Turganur, Ankanahalli and villages and Gram Panchayat limits, according to a press release from CESC Executive Engineer, Nanjangud Division.
